So Green, let me be very clear on this one...

You have 2 ~ 4 ft 6500k florescent tubes on these plants only, or is it a 4 tube set?

I am going to steal some from my sweetie's shop so I want to make sure I steal the right ones! LOL!

I have 2 ft ones I use for my clones and I also have t-5's in 2 ft, but I need these other places.
I have 4 single bulb T8 fixtures in my veg box for 2ft long T8 bulbs - so the shortest T8 bulb form. The more common one is the T8 with 4ft which also got a little higher lumen output then the short 2ft ones.

I used my normal Vegging tubes for the experiment with blue 6500K / Cool Light which are in the same spectrum as MH-bulbs. For flowering the spectrum isn't optimal as it is to far on the blue side and flowering takes more red light (HPS therefor 2700K), so if you don't want to exactly erasable my little experiment you should go for a couple new tubes in 2700K / Warm light.


Quote:
Originally Posted by jangel View Post

I want to put back in veg some of my flowering plants so just want the minimum to get them vegging, not a ton of light to flower them.....

Love ya Green!
For that task a set of double T8s with 6500K tubes will be fine, they will wisted anyways when returning from flowering to vegetative state. You might have to trim them later on that way Jangel, but those cuttings can be turned into clones as well.
